The photoconductivity of a two-dimensional electron gas (2DEG) has been mea
sured under intense, polarised THz radiation. Cyclotron resonance is eviden
t to high temperature and yields a large effective mass, which increases wi
th radiation intensity. No shift in the magneto-phonon resonance fields is
observed attributable to the radiation. (C) 1998 Elsevier Science B.V. All
